A custom Adirondack chair cover is a waterproof cover cut to the exact shape of your own chair. The pattern follows the wide flat arms, the raked back and the sloping seat. Adirondack chair covers are made one at a time, from the measurements you send. There is no small, medium or large to pick between.
Adirondack chairs are not one shape. Wide flat arms, a tall fanned back, a seat that drops toward the ground. Every maker builds them a little differently, so a cover that fits one will not fit the next.

Because the chair is widest in its middle. The arms are the widest part of an Adirondack, about halfway up. Almost everything else outdoors is widest at the base.
So universal covers are cut narrow at the top and wide at the bottom. That is upside down for this chair. The cover fouls on the arms going on, then rides up and leaves the legs bare.
Then there is the size spread. Polywood puts its own Adirondack range at 34 to 44 inches tall, 24 to 33 inches wide and 24 to 38 inches deep. That is a ten-inch spread in every direction, across chairs all sold under the same name. Universal covers come in about two sizes.

An Adirondack seat slopes down toward the back. Rain runs to the bottom of that slope and sits there. A cover shaped to your chair sheds it instead.
Water standing in the joints turns to ice and works them apart over a winter. Keep the water out and a freeze has nothing left to lift.
Rain does not fall straight down in the open. Wind pushes it sideways, into the slat gaps and under the arms, where it sits and soaks in.

The chair on its own. The cover has to be widest across the arms and taper both ways — up over the fanned back, down to the legs. Get that wrong and it either will not pass the arms or it rides up and leaves the base open. Arm span, overall height and depth front to back are what the pattern is cut from.
The chair with its matching ottoman standing in front. A chair-and-ottoman cover is the harder one to make, and the one universal covers get most wrong. A chair and an ottoman are two separate objects with open air between them, so a rectangular cover thrown over both tents across the gap. That tented span is the lowest unsupported point of the whole set, which is exactly where rain collects with nothing underneath to hold it up.
